Handover for the Greywick metrics-aggregation sidecar: it runs alongside each Portico API pod and flushes rollups every 30 seconds. If counters stall, restart the sidecar only, not the main container. Owen has the dashboards bookmarked under the Greywick folder. The sidecar boots with these configuration values.

deployment values, kajep-kageg:
[praix]
host = praix.paliqcorp.corp
user = praix_svc
database = praix_prod

First check consumer lag on the `crash-raw` topic; if consumers are healthy, the usual culprit is the symbolication service rejecting uploads. Restart symbolication pods only after draining in-flight jobs, otherwise partial symbol files poison the cache. Manual replay via `shattergram replay --from-buffer` requires authenticating against the internal pipeline API. The key for that call is provided here.

app token of bahaf-tajeg = zpat23_SjjsllwiLmXbtS65veZaV47

Fan-out backpressure for the Quillet notifier: when the queue depth crosses the soft limit, the dispatcher sheds low-priority pushes and batches the rest at 500ms intervals. Reviewer should confirm the shed counter is exported and that retries respect the jitter window. Once merged, the release artifact gets re-signed by the pipeline, which expects the deploy key shown below.

deploy key for bawep-yawif: bky6_GQhaSt

Welcome to on-call for the Glimmerpane design system! Our snapshot tests live in the `snapcheck` suite and run on every merge to main. If a UI component changes visually, the diff bot flags it — usually it's an intentional tweak, so just approve the new baseline. If it's 2am and snapshots are failing across the board, it's almost always a font-loading race, not your problem. To unlock the baseline store and re-approve snapshots in bulk, use the recovery passphrase below.

recovery phrase for tahag-taguf: wenix-caswyn